Transaction 17a99142be17837121fc7a2698cc2964a660767a2771686c9ab9d8176221d86e
1 Input
1 Output
-
17a99142be17837121fc7a2698cc2964a660767a2771686c9ab9d8176221d86e:0
- value
- 9956148
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ccf6e5e7dff17a26f7a47570815f17fcae27986
- address
- bc1qtn8kuhnalut6ymm6gatss9030l9wy7vxd67eps